Estée Lauder Companies Interviews FAQs
Glassdoor users rated their interview experience at Estée Lauder Companies as 61.5% positive with a difficulty rating score of 2.73 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ty). Candidates interviewing for Senior Director Marketing and Team Leader rated their interviews as the hardest, whereas interviews for Lead Advisor and Consumer roles were rated as the easiest.
The hiring process at Estée Lauder Companies takes an average of 26.49 days when considering 488 user submitted interviews across all job titles. Candidates applying for Planner had the quickest hiring process (on average 1 day), whereas Supply Manager roles had the slowest hiring process (on average 270 days).
Common stages of the interview process at Estée Lauder Companies according to 488 Glassdoor interviews include:
Phone Interview: 24.01%
One on One Interview: 23.81%
Presentation: 10.42%
Drug Test: 8.73%
Background Check: 7.94%
Skills Test: 7.04%
Group Panel Interview: 5.95%
IQ Intelligence Test: 5.56%
Personality Test: 3.57%
Other: 2.98%
